無理をすること
muri o suru kotoThe act of forcing oneself beyond one's limits, often leading to physical or mental exhaustion
無理をすることでストレスがたまる
Pushing yourself too hard accumulates stress

📖Word Origin
Composed of 無理 (muri, meaning 'impossible' or 'excessive') and すること (suru koto, meaning 'to do'), literally 'the act of doing something impossible'
📝Usage Notes
This phrase is often used to caution against overworking or pushing oneself beyond reasonable limits, highlighting the importance of self-care and balance.
